[SQL] Databricks SQL yyyyMMdd 형태 날짜 다루기

데이터 분석/[SQL] 기초

[SQL] Databricks SQL yyyyMMdd 형태 날짜 다루기

INCHELIN 2024. 1. 9. 10:59
728x90

 

yyyyMMdd형태의 경우 date_format함수를 그냥 써버리면 에러가 난다

 

date_format(from_unixtime(unix_timestamp(date_column, 'yyyyMMdd'), 'yyyyMMdd')

 

date_format의 두번째 인자에는 원하는 형태의 타입을 작성하면된다

만약 연월만 보고싶으면 'yyyyMM' 형태를 바꾸고싶으면 'yyyy-MM-dd'

728x90